Good People General Store I sell vintage items and much more! Who are Good People? Our candles are made from 100% natural soy, throw a fine fragrance, and offer a very long burn time.

Good People Candles are inspired by the “Good People” series of paintings by Katrina Estes-Hill, also known as “Mizippihippi”. Well, Good People are ordinary folks like you and me who make up the fabric of the American, mostly Southern, culture. Many of us go unnoticed, but all of us have a story to tell, and Good People candles have a wee bit of that story right smack dab on the label. They are p

oured and packaged with love in Louisville, MS. Katrina was born and raised there in Winston County, and much of the inspiration for her paintings came from home. Ordinary folks inspire the characters on the labels and the characters on the labels inspire the unique scent of the candles. The little anecdote on the label will enlighten you on how the character inspired the fragrance.
